Default XL2007 Save Thumbnail

When XL2007 is running under Vista, the Save As dialog contains a Save
Thumbnail checkbox which if checked creates a thumbail image of (I guess)
the active worksheet that can be subsequently displayed in the Open dialog.

I've tried recording a macro that captures a Save As with and without the
Thumbnail property checked and see no difference in the arguments.

My snarfing around in the object model help also didn't surface anything.

Does anybody know how this can be controlled? To ensure that when my code
saves a workbook that a thumbnail is saved with it? Is there anyway to
control the saved thumbnail image?
